Purpose of Oral Feeding
To provide adequate nutrition and be in control of a proper diet to the your loved ones.
As people grow older, their body system also degenerates which affects the digestion and nutrient absorption.
Reminders:
- Ensure patient is in sitting position.
- Do not give food/drink when patient is lying down
- Be patient - follow the patient's pace
- Eg: Parkinson or Dementia patients
- Encourage the patient to chew/swallow if they keep the food in the mouth.
4. Small amounts at each feeding. Cut the food into small bite portions, to
prevent choking.
4. Don't underfeed/overfeed the patient
5. Don't force the patient to eat all the food that presented on the plate.
